Restroom Floor Replacement in Baltimore, MD
Restroom floor replacement services involve removing and installing new flooring materials in bathrooms to improve appearance, functionality, and safety. This service covers a variety of projects, including replacing worn or damaged tiles, vinyl, laminate, or other flooring types commonly found in residential bathrooms. Homeowners typically seek this service when their current flooring shows signs of cracking, water damage, or general wear, or when updating the style of the space to match new fixtures or design preferences.
Property owners considering restroom floor replacement often want to understand the scope of work involved, the types of flooring options available, and how the process may impact their daily routines. It's important to consider factors such as moisture resistance, durability, and maintenance requirements when choosing new flooring. Clarifying the project's timeline, potential disruptions, and the removal process can help ensure the renovation meets expectations and enhances the bathroom’s overall comfort and appearance.

Restroom Floor Replacement Questions
What are common reasons for restroom floor replacement? Damage from water leaks, mold growth, or age-related wear often lead property owners to consider replacing restroom floors.
What types of flooring materials are available for replacement? Options include ceramic tile, vinyl, laminate, and epoxy coatings, each offering different durability and appearance.
Is floor replacement necessary for minor damages? Usually, minor cracks or surface wear can be repaired, but extensive damage typically requires full floor replacement.
How does floor replacement improve restroom safety? Replacing worn or damaged flooring reduces the risk of slips and falls, creating a safer environment for users.
